Vega Baja weather in August (Puerto Rico)

Curious about the August weather in Vega Baja? Wondering if it's the right time to visit? Browse this page for a comprehensive overview of the weather conditions for that month.

In August, Vega Baja generally has very high temperatures and high rainfall. Throughout the daytime, temperatures often hover around 32°C. However, as the sun sets and evening approaches, there's a noticeable cool-down, with temperatures gently dropping to a more temperate 25°C. Often, it stands out as the year's warmest month. With this in mind, cool breathable fabrics will make navigating the heat much more bearable. Always be ready to embrace the warmth while staying cool and protected.

Vega Baja in August usually receives high rainfall, averaging around 102 mm for the month. Delving into the climate records from the past 30 years, one can predict that nearly 20 days of the month will see rainfall.

With around 267 hours of sunshine, the days are mostly sunny. It gives a pleasant and vibrant feel to the area.

If you're looking for dry conditions and comfortable temperatures, August may not be the ideal month to visit Vega Baja. January, February, March and December typically offer the most agreeable circumstances. On the other hand, April, May, August, September, October and November tend to be characterized by conditions that may not be as optimal.

Vega Baja, monthly averages in August

Min TemperatureMin Temperature 25°C  
Max TemperatureMax Temperature 32°C  
Chance of RainChance of Rain 65%  
PrecipitationPrecipitation 102 mm  
Rainy daysRainy days 20 days  
HumidityHumidity 76% *  
SunshineSunshine 267 hours *  
Percentage SunshinePercentage Sunshine 68% *  
* Data from: San Juan, Puerto Rico (40 KM, 25 Miles).
